Aurit Zamir

Aurit Zamir (born July 26, 1972) is an Israeli filmmaker, active as a producer, director and screenwriter as well as the director of the Sam Spiegel Film and Television School International Film Lab.

Zamir produced Ruthy Pribar’s ''Asia'', which was Israel’s entry into the 2020 Academy Awards for best foreign film, and won 9 Israeli Academy Awards, including Best Film.
